Preparation Checklist Before Your Furniture Collection
A little preparation can make a furniture pick-up much easier. You do not need to do anything complicated, but clearing the route and confirming what is being removed helps the team work efficiently. It also reduces the chance of confusion if multiple rooms or floors are involved.
Before the collection day, it helps to:
- Identify all furniture you want removed and separate it from items you are keeping.
- Check whether large items need dismantling before collection.
- Measure doorways, stairwells, and shared access if you know space is tight.
- Make sure pathways are clear of clutter, cables, and fragile items.
- Reserve or allow access to lifts, bays, or parking where needed.
- Tell household members, tenants, or staff what time to expect the collection.
If you are unsure whether something needs to be prepared in advance, ask when arranging the pick-up. Some items are easier to remove intact, while others may need partial dismantling to fit through the property safely. Good communication beforehand makes the day far simpler.
Pricing Factors to Understand Before You Book
Customers often want to know what affects the cost of furniture collection. While exact prices depend on the specific job, there are a few common factors that usually shape the quote. Understanding them helps you compare options more fairly and avoids surprises later.
Typical pricing factors include:
- Volume and size of items: A single chair is different from a full room of furniture.
- Weight and handling: Solid wood or oversized pieces may take more effort to move.
- Access conditions: Upper floors, narrow staircases, or restricted parking can affect the work involved.
- Number of collection points: Multiple rooms or separate buildings may require extra time.
- Urgency and timing: Short-notice or out-of-hours appointments may need special scheduling.
It is always sensible to provide clear details when requesting a quote. The more accurate your description, the more likely you are to receive a realistic estimate. Photos can sometimes help, especially for larger or awkward pieces, but even a written item list is useful.
